Transaction 85687283f0bfab07c2def148d5b4de6389b8d869a67ab702c7e5ac2af3590229
1 Input
1 Output
-
85687283f0bfab07c2def148d5b4de6389b8d869a67ab702c7e5ac2af3590229:0
- value
- 163500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f062f6b3fbba2bfa4dde9d72c96ea535b04f03ee OP_EQUAL
- address
- 3Pc4ehaEzBxfm44yiT6pPSayELzfZwrWaM